Photographer captures stunning close-up of great white shark's razor-sharp teeth

A photographer has given his followers a terrifying look inside the jaws of a great white shark.

Euan Rannachan, who regularly shares mesmerising sealife shots with his 77,200 followers on Instagram (@euanart), filmed the video in the waters surrounding Guadalupe Island, Mexico.

He later uploaded the clip to YouTube but also shared a close-up of the shark's gaping mouth on Instagram, with its razor-sharp teeth gleaming.

"This shark had been coming in and out all day, bossing all the other sharks around and not letting any of the others go for the bait," Euan said.

“Towards the end of the day, he finally decided that he wanted a snack and started getting more aggressive with the bait himself."

Scary close-ups are Euan's "favourite" kind of photos to take.

He said: “I believe we saw 12 brand new sharks that trip.

“I loved it. One of my favourite types of photos to get when shooting great white sharks is the shot through the gills.

"This clip has that and also a great view of the rows of teeth as he went past."

In the video clip, which has nearly 7,000 views, the great white can be seen lunging for the bait.

As the camera moves closer, viewers can see the gaps between the animal's gills and the vast expanse of its impressive jaws.

The shark's black eyes roll past the camera and viewers get close enough to see the water rolling over the gills.

"What an unpleasant place," wrote one user who didn't seem too impressed by the shark-infested waters.

Euan, who loves the prehistoric creatures, leads his own shark dives as part of Be A Shark Adventure Travel, where members of the public can learn more about these amazing fish.

Despite their reputation as apex predators, great whites are considered a vulnerable species due to hunting and threats to their habitat.
